Output f588a6ef48f2ea707df5c851524fb95a3f96428c62054f759f7cc9ad43bc2428:18

value
104970000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 398ad88c4275b691385b2592af4cd5f82a348c51 OP_EQUALVERIFY OP_CHECKSIG
address
16FFr7ivcDXH2455rbtCy8kwiwZvdAiGVY
transaction
f588a6ef48f2ea707df5c851524fb95a3f96428c62054f759f7cc9ad43bc2428
spent
true